Abstract

Three novel coordination polymers, [Ag(N–N)2]X (N–N = 4,4′-bipyridyl, X = CF3SO3––1; N–N = 4-cyanopyridine, X = BF4–, in two polymorphs, 2 and 3)], are prepared and investigated by single crystal X-ray analysis; 1 and 2 contain three-dimensional cationic frameworks, both consisting of four equivalent interpenetrating diamondoid lattices, while 3 is formed by two-dimensional layers of distorted squares.
